锹鳞龙属(属名:Stagonolepis)是种已灭绝主龙类爬行动物,属于坚蜥目,生存于三叠纪晚期的诺利期。锹鳞龙的化石已在苏格兰波兰发现。

锹鳞龙是种四足、植食性动物,身体覆盖者厚重鳞甲。锹鳞龙行动缓慢,牠们使用厚重骨板来抵抗同时代伪鳄类掠食动物的攻击。锹鳞龙身长3米,头部长达25公分;与身体相比,锹鳞龙的头部非常小头部少于身体长度的10%。牠们的嘴部前段没有牙齿,嘴部后段有适合咀嚼的钉状牙齿,但喙状嘴的前端往上拱起,可让锹鳞龙拔起植物(类似现在的),包括木贼蕨类植物、以及苏铁[1]

模式种S. robertsoni,化石发现于苏格兰的洛西茅斯砂岩层;第二个种是S. olenkae,化石发现于波兰,地质年代比模式种还年轻[2]

某些古生物学家认为,发现于南美洲Aetosauroides,是锹鳞龙的次异名Aetosauroides目前有两个种:A. scagliaiA. subsulcatus。在2002年,史宾赛·卢卡斯(Spencer G. Lucas)将体形较大的种,归类于锹鳞龙的S. robertsoni,较小的种则归类于S. wellesi[3]

一些发现于美国的化石,生存同年也是三叠纪晚期,原本是独立属Calyptosuchus,曾被改归类成锹鳞龙的第三个种S. wellesi。大部分研究认为锹鳞龙、Calyptosuchus是两个单系源,是两个有效的独立属[4][5][6][7]
